# Tidewren Environments

Tidewren is the stale-branch cleanup bot for the Copperleaf monorepo. It runs in three environments: dev (dry-run only), staging (deletes against a mirror), and prod (deletes for real, with a 14-day grace window).

Support notes: if a user claims a branch vanished, check the prod audit log first — Tidewren never deletes branches with open review requests. Most complaints trace back to the grace window being shorter than people expect. The prod environment runs with the following settings.

config for bahof-tagep:
kelael:
  pin: 3701
  tenant: fraius
  seal: seal_566287a7
  metrics_host: metrics.kelael.ferradyn.local
  standby_team: sormir
  escalation: juldor-oliir
  nonce: 530523

Date rendering in Larkspan now respects locale-specific formats rather than forcing the ISO layout everywhere. Affected surfaces: invoice headers, the activity timeline, and export filenames. Note for on-call: if a locale falls back to the default pattern, check the Quillbox formatting table before assuming a rendering bug — missing entries fall back silently by design. Parsing of user-entered dates is unchanged in this release; only display changed. Pages related to this rollout should go to the engineer named below.

approver of faduf-bagug = Framir Sorwyn

Runbook: Streamline Gateway. WebSocket permessage-deflate is disabled by default on Streamline Gateway because compression of attacker-influenced frames enables CRIME-style inference against session tokens. Enabling it cuts bandwidth roughly 40% on the telemetry channel, so the Varnholt team runs it only on authenticated internal links. If you approve compression for a tenant, rotate the channel signing secret first. Add the following line to the gateway env file.

env line for fafof-fahag: LEDGER_TOKEN5=f8790